Transaction 98211768ce1e9e20e4bada63f5d79c64c111e24cefb13e4e3d1367bc066b0170

1 Input
1 Outputs
  • 98211768ce1e9e20e4bada63f5d79c64c111e24cefb13e4e3d1367bc066b0170:0
  • value  558456
    address  31xaT36xkwfqcrcuhC2M1UD8XChW7bhBrd